Hallo, Gast! (Registrieren)

Letzte Ankündigung: MyBB 1.8.38 veröffentlicht (30.04.24)


Benutzer, die gerade dieses Thema anschauen: 2 Gast/Gäste
.php Inhalt einbinden
#11
Ok mal ein kleines Beispiel:

Ich habe ein Formular im Template.
In diesem Formular befindet sich ein Button.

Wenn ich nun den Button klicke, soll darunter ein Text erscheinen, den ich vorher in einer Variable gespeichert habe.

Wie setzte ich das jetzt am besten um?
#12
Du fügst die Variable ins Template ein...
[Bild: banner.png]

Bitte die Foren-Regeln beachten und im Profil die verwendete MyBB-Version angeben.
#13
im Template {$var} und im impressum.php der code, seh ich das richtig?
Freundliche Grüsse
Marti95.

Die deutsche Rechtschreibung ist Freeware, dass heißt Du darfst sie kostenlos benutzen.
Sie ist allerdings nicht Open Source, dass heißt Du darfst sie weder verändern, noch in veränderter Form veröffentlichen.
#14
Hallo Rev0,

hier mal ein anderes Beispiel:

Template "hello"
Code:
<html>
<head>
<title>{$settings['bbname']} - Hallo Welt</title>
{$headerinclude}
</head>
<body>
{$header}
<table border="0" cellspacing="{$theme['borderwidth']}" cellpadding="{$theme['tablespace']}" class="tborder">
<tr>
<td class="thead"><strong>Hallo Welt</strong></td>
</tr>
<tr>
<td class="trow1" align="center">
<!-- hier wird die Variable "$hello_text" (aus Datei "hello.php") ausgegeben -->
{$hello_text}
</td>
</tr>
</table>
{$footer}
</body>
</html>

Datei "hello.php"
PHP-Code:
<?php
define
("IN_MYBB"1);
//define("NO_ONLINE", 1); // Wenn Seite nicht in Wer ist online-Liste auftauchen soll
 
require("global.php");

add_breadcrumb("Hallo Welt");

// hier wird die Variable "$hello_text" definiert, die durch das Template "hello" ausgegeben wird
$hello_text "Hallo Welt!";

eval(
"\$hello = \"".$templates->get("hello")."\";"); // Hier wird das erstellte Template geladen
output_page($hello);
?>